1. Your Measurements Are Taken Properly
One of the biggest problems with ready-made suits is fit.
Shoulders may be too wide. Sleeves may be too long. The jacket may feel tight when you sit.
A professional custom suit tailor carefully measures important points such as:
- Shoulder width
- Chest and waist balance
- Jacket length
- Sleeve pitch
- Trouser break
- Collar gap
These small technical details make a huge difference. When the measurements are correct, the suit naturally follows the shape of your body.

The Real Difference Is in the Details
Tailoring is often misunderstood as just “taking measurements.” But real craftsmanship goes deeper.
For example:
- A good jacket requires correct canvas construction so the fabric drapes naturally over the chest.
- The lapel roll must sit smoothly rather than lying flat like a machine-made suit.
- A proper trouser break ensures the pants fall neatly over the shoes.
- Other details such as hand stitching, fabric weights, and interlining can also influence the comfort and longevity of the clothing.
- The technical aspects mentioned above are seldom visible in the lighting in a shop window display, but they can make a huge difference in how the clothing feels during the day.
